Rack Requirements
The SRX380 Services Gateway is designed to be installed on four-post racks. Table 15 on page 34 provides
the rack requirements and specifications for the SRX380.
Table 15: Rack Requirements for the SRX380 Services Gateway
GuidelinesRack Requirement
Use a four-post rack that provides bracket holes or hole patterns spaced at 1-U (1.75 in.
or 4.45 cm) increments and that meets the size and strength requirements to support the
weight of the device.
Rack type
The holes in the mounting brackets are spaced at 1-U (1.75 in. or 4.45 cm) increments.
The device can be mounted in any four-post rack that provides holes spaced at that
distance.
Mounting bracket hole
spacing
•
Ensure that the rack complies with the standards for a 19-in. rack as defined in Cabinets,
Racks, Panels, and Associated Equipment (document number EIA-310–D) published by
the Electronics Industry Association.
•
Ensure that the rack rails are spaced widely enough to accommodate the external
dimensions of the chassis. The outer edges of the front-mounting brackets extend the
width to 19 in. (48.26 cm).
•
For four-post installations, the front and rear rack rails must be spaced between 23.6
in. (60 cm) and 36 in. (91.4 cm) front to back.
•
The rack must be strong enough to support the weight of the device.
•
Ensure that the spacing of rails and adjacent racks provides for proper clearance around
the device and rack.
Rack size and strength
•
Secure the rack to the building structure.
•
If earthquakes are a possibility in your geographical area, secure the rack to the floor.
•
Secure the rack to the ceiling brackets and to wall or floor brackets for maximum stability.
